Rossi's Find a Suitable Setting

BOLOGNA - Ducati rider, Valentino Rossi, admitted his team had found a satisfactory setting for the bike. For him this would be a good basis to be able to race at Jerez next week.

Ducatti was not able to find the best setting for the bike riders. The result would be felt when the race, with Rossi only managed to reach the top 10 at the end of the race at the Losail circuit, Qatar, while her colleague Nicky Hayden took the sixth position.

"At the end of the third day of testing in March, we have found a satisfactory setting for the GP12, so we have a basis for initiating this track (Jerez) as well as we prepare for the race bike," said Rossi, quoted by Autosport, Wednesday (25 / 4/2012).

MotoGP title holder ever with seven world titles will try setting it on a practice session on Friday and Saturday. Rossi also explained what was to be the focus in the practice session ahead of the race.

"It would be very important to work well during the day on Friday and Saturday practice sessions, focusing on maintaining a good direction and take advantage of what we do today," he added.

Poor outcome in Qatar seems to be a crack Rossi to get up and perform better in Jerez. "I really like the track in Jerez and we should try to be better than during the race in Qatar," he said.
